About the job
10+ years of professional experience in Java backend development. Expert-level proficiency in Java programming, including knowledge of Aspect-Oriented Programming (AOP). Deep experience with the Spring and Hibernate frameworks. Strong knowledge and proven application of REST API principles and architecture. Experience with Oracle SQL databases and Linux environments. Understanding and ability to apply secure coding rules and best practices. Basic understanding of major cloud platforms (AWS, GCP, or Azure). Knowledge and practical experience with CI / CD tools and processes. Highly Desirable Skills (Advantageous) • Experience with Message Queue systems (e.g., Active MQ or Kafka). • Experience with build automation tools (e.g., Maven). • Experience with client-side web application development (HTML, JavaScript, CSS, JSP) and frameworks (Angular or React). • Prior experience developing in large, complex software systems. • Familiarity with modern deployment technologies (Go, Docker, and Kubernetes).
Requirements
- Java
- Spring
- Hibernate
- REST APIs
- Oracle SQL
- Microservices
Qualifications
- 10+ years experience in Java backend development
Preferred Technologies
- Java
- Spring
- Hibernate
- REST APIs
- Oracle SQL
- Microservices
Similar Jobs
Java Backend Developer
Tata Consultancy Services
Java Backend Developer
People Prime Worldwide
Java Backend Developer
People Prime Worldwide